Latest Patents

Jessica's latest patents include her advancements in silane-crosslinkable polymeric compositions. One of her key inventions involves a polyolefin that includes hydrolyzable silane groups, combined with an acidic silanol condensation catalyst, and a phenolic antioxidant. This antioxidant possesses a phenol-based moiety that is fused with a cyclic ether, strategically placing the oxygen atom in the para position relative to the hydroxyl group of the phenolic structure. Such innovative compositions are particularly beneficial in the wire and cable industry, providing enhanced stability and performance. Another similar patent further emphasizes her unique approach in developing polymer compositions featuring phenolic antioxidants with sulfur-containing radicals positioned at both the ortho and para locations relative to the hydroxyl group. These advancements contribute significantly to the manufacturing of durable and efficient polymer products.
